Google’s search engine, e-mail and interactive maps will come preloaded on the mobile phone it plans to launch early next year. The company hopes that the new GPhone will rival the Apple iPhone. Google is expected to be seeking revenue from the lucrative mobile advertising market. A new market survey released by ChangeWave Research found that 16% of early technology adopters who plan to buy a cell phone in the next six months will buy an iPhone. The research also suggests that Motorola has suffered the largest losses from the iPhone. (TWICE 8/6) According to the Web site AppleInsider, Apple’s iPhone will soon be available through Best Buy and other retailers. The site cited “people familiar with the matter” and said Best Buy could begin carrying the iPhone in September or October. (Dealerscope 8/6)
